Substrates and Products (Substrate)

EC Number Substrates Comment Substrates Organism Products Comment (Products) Rev. Reac.
2.3.1.42 acyl-CoA + dihydroxyacetone phosphate no acyl-donors are C4-C10-acyl-CoAs Rattus norvegicus CoA + acyldihydroxyacetone phosphate i.e. acylglycerone phosphate ?
2.3.1.42 dodecanoyl-CoA + dihydroxyacetone phosphate
-
Rattus norvegicus CoA + dodecanoyldihydroxyacetone phosphate
-
?
2.3.1.42 oleoyl-CoA + dihydroxyacetone phosphate
-
Rattus norvegicus CoA + oleoyldihydroxyacetone phosphate
-
?
2.3.1.42 palmitoyl-CoA + dihydroxyacetone phosphate best substrate Rattus norvegicus CoA + monopalmitoyldihydroxyacetone phosphate
-
?
2.3.1.42 stearoyl-CoA + dihydroxyacetone phosphate
-
Rattus norvegicus CoA + stearoyldihydroxyacetone phosphate
-
?
2.3.1.42 tetradecanoyl-CoA + dihydroxyacetone phosphate i.e. myristoyl-CoA Rattus norvegicus CoA + tetradecanoyldihydroxyacetone phosphate
-
?

pH Optimum

EC Number pH Optimum Minimum pH Optimum Maximum Comment Organism
2.3.1.42 7 7.4
-
Rattus norvegicus

pH Range

EC Number pH Minimum pH Maximum Comment Organism
2.3.1.42 6.5 8.5 about half-maximal activity at pH 6.5 and pH 8.5 Rattus norvegicus
